

Disc 1. The Movie: When Randle P. McMurphy (Jack Nicholson), a free-spirited con man, enters the state psychiatric hospital feigning insanity, his infectious tendency toward disorder rises against the stony ruin. Soon a threatening war will begin. On one side is McMunphy, on the other, Nurse Ratched (Louise Fletcher), one of the coldest characters in the history of cinema. The fate of every patient on the ward is at stake.
With a new digital image from restored elements, the adaptation of the acclaimed bestseller by Ken Kelsey won, in 1975, the five great Oscars® of the Academy: Best Picture (produced by Saul Zaentz and Michael Douglas), Best Actor (Jack Nicholson ), Best Actress (Louise Fletcher), Best Director (Milos Forman) and Best Adapted Screenplay (Lawrence Hauben and Bo Goldman). Brilliant, original and with a luxury cast that includes Brand Dourif, Danny DeVito and Christopher Lloyd in his film debut, this film is included among the greatest film productions.
